In the light of his obsession with territory and its aesthetic representation, Alban Duchateau builds up a suspended time in the intimacy of urban planning, tying together lines and geometrical volumes, as well as a enigmatic absraction with tangible geography.

 

Influenced by Théo Van Doesburg, J.R., Georges Perec’s brutalism, he creates a hybrid and subjective view of cartography. In a sensitive and reserved way, You Are Here intends to comprehend the city’s architecture, a reflective break toward its surroundings.
